Correct, Give a few days’ notice (not last minute), Have a simple back-up plan (Plan B), Offer 2 options (“Want to come over Sat or Sun?”), Be friendly and confident when you invite, Use a normal voice and relaxed body language, If they say no, stay calm and say “No worries”, Thank them for letting you know, Try inviting someone else another time, Follow house rules (snacks, devices, spaces), Check in during the hangout (“Want to do X next?”), Incorrect, Invite someone you’ve never spoken to, Invite a huge group for your first get-together, Make it an overnight stay for the first hangout, Plan something super expensive, Invite them with no warning (“Come now!”), Keep changing the plan over and over, Pressure them to say yes, Ask again and again after they say no, Say “Why not?” or argue if they decline, Insult them if they’re busy, Only invite them to do what you want, Ignore your parent/carer’s rules, Have no plan at all and hope it works out, Show up at their house without asking, Invite them when you’re angry or upset, Spend the whole time on your phone without checking in
